    Who I am

     

    My name is Sarah Weaver. The type of counselling I offer is  Humanistic and Integrative. That means that I believe you, as the client, hold the capacity to sow your own seeds towards new and healthy growth. In order to help this along we will work together in the way that best suits your own individua[ needs. I believe the relationship that we develop provides a significant  aspect of the healing process.

    ​

    It might be that you are struggling with feelings of depression or anxiety. You may have relationship, or self- esteem problems. Maybe you just don’t feel ‘yourself’. What ever it might be that is bothering you I am here to accept and greet you. Please don’t feel that you have to have reached rock bottom. I believe counselling is for everyone and that we can all benefit from it at different times  in our lives.

     So what is counselling?

    We all have times in life when we find it hard to cope. Sometimes we have a lack of understanding about what is happening to us. We may feel anxious, desperate or very alone. 

    ​

    Having someone to talk to can lighten the load and make things seem more manageble. 

     

    I will provide a safe space for you  to bring what you need to to the sessions. 

     

    I will listen to you in a non- judgemental way and together we can try to make sense of your experiences and feelings.

    ​

    Sometimes this involves distinguishing patterns from the past and finding links to what is happening in the present

     

    I believe in working towards  you developing a deeper, more fulfilling relationship with yourself.

    ​

    I also offer Walk and talk sessions. This can be helpful if you would like to be in nature, walking side by side rather than face to face in a room. It takes place at Oldbury Court in Fishponds.

    Cost

    I charge £55.00 for a fifty minute session. The first session is for us both to get a feel for what it might be like to work together. It is important to feel comfortable and relaxed with the counsellor you choose.

    ​

    Walk and Talk sessions last for 60 minutes and are charged at the cost of £60.00
